C语言学生档案管理.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
C语言学生档案管理

《C程序设计语言》课程设计 实践报告 题 目: 学生档案管理 班 级: 信息N082 学 号: 200845209212 姓 名: 叶吕根 同组人员: 仇灵晓 俞通 梅佳华 指导教师: 仇芒仙 完成日期: 2011-10-21 目 录 1.问题描述 1 2.算法分析 1 3.程序功能模块 2 3.1 总功能模块图 2 3.2 功能分析 3 4.程序相关代码 4 4.1查询学生信息模块 4 4.2删除学生信息模块 7 5.程序运行结果 11 5.1 查询学生信息 11 5.2 删除学生信息 12 6. 实习体会心得与使用说明 13 学生档案管理 1.问题描述 随着科学技术的发展,计算机管理在日常生活中的地位变得越来越重要。它能够代替人做各种重复,繁琐的劳动,并且拥有操作简单,可信度好,不易出错等优点,大大减少了不必要的人力消耗,提高个人的工作效率。学生档案管理是每个学校必须面临的问题,所以,如何开发一个应用简单,见面友好,容易操作,数据安全性好的管理系统就成为非常重要的技术问题。 系统开发的总体任务是实现学生关系的系统化,规范化和自动化本学生管理系统需要完成的功能有 3.2 功能分析 “学生档案管理”包括6个模块:输入学生信息;显示学生信息;按姓名查找或按学号查找,并显示;按姓名删除或按学号删除;按学号查找并修改;退出系统。每个模块既相互联系又相互独立。 (1) 输入学生信息模块: 主要功能用来对学生的档案进行输入。档案录入需要输入学生信息,比如姓名,学号,专业。在准确输入学生的信息后,系统会提示是否继续进行操作,如果想继续添加学生信息就输入该学生的学号,不像再输入学生信息的话就输入0,系统返回到主菜单。 (2) 显示学生信息模块: 主要功能用来对学生的信息进行输出。在系统已经录入了学生信息的前提下,使用该功能可以显示所以学生的信息。在查看学生的信息后,按0就可以返回到主菜单。 (3) 按姓名查找或按学号查找,并显示模块: 主要功能是用来查找学生资料。想要查找某一学生的信息,可以输入该学生的姓名或学号进行查找,这样系统就会显示该学生的信息。 (4) 按姓名删除或按学号删除模块: 主要功能是用来删除学生信息,想删除某一学生的信息,可以输入学生姓名或学号,系统找到该学生信息后,就可以删除了。 (5) 按学号查找并修改模块: 主要功能是用来修改学生信息。想要修改某一学生的信息,可以输入该学生的学号,系统就会显示该学生的信息,再选择需要修改的某一条信息进行修改。 (6) 退出 主要功能是用来退出系统。如果学生的信息都已经录入完毕,则可以按0退出系统。 4.程序相关代码 4.1查询学生信息模块 4.1.1查询学生信息模块的N-S图 4.1.2查询学生信息模块的程序代码 void Qur(PI * pi) { int sel,i,num; SAL * p; char name[15]; /*p为指向数据序列首部的指针*/ p=pi-pHead; Menu(); /*1:按学号查询;2:按姓名查询;其他:返回*/ printf(1--------------------------按学号查询\n); printf(2--------------------------按姓名查询 \n); printf(任意键--------------返回\n); printf(请输入你的选择:[1,2]? ); scanf(%d,sel); if(sel!=1sel!=2) { return; } if(sel==1) /*按学号查询*/ { printf(请输入查询的学号: ); scanf(%d,num); for(i=1;i=pi-count;i++) { if(num==p-num) { break; } p++; } /*没有找到记录的情况*/ if(ipi-c

文档评论(0)

xcs88858 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8130065136000003

1亿VIP精品文档

相关文档